Understanding Autophagy During Intermittent Fasting

As the founder of CFP Weight Loss, I've spent years helping people in their late 40s and 50s break through stubborn weight plateaus caused by hormonal changes, diabetes, and joint pain. One of the most powerful tools we use is autophagy, the body's natural recycling process that kicks in during extended periods without food. When you practice intermittent fasting, typically a 16:8 or 18:6 window, insulin levels drop and autophagy ramps up around the 14-16 hour mark. This cellular cleanup reduces inflammation, improves insulin sensitivity, and makes fat burning more efficient—exactly what we need when every past diet has failed.

Recommended Books on Autophagy and Fasting

The most practical guide remains Dr. Yoshinori Ohsumi's Nobel Prize-winning research translated in Autophagy: Nobel Prize Research Explained, but for everyday readers I recommend The Complete Guide to Fasting by Dr. Jason Fung and Jimmy Moore. It dedicates entire chapters to how autophagy destroys damaged cells, fights age-related hormonal slowdown, and supports sustainable weight loss without insurance-covered programs.

Another standout is Fast. Feast. Repeat. by Gin Stephens, which includes beginner protocols that fit busy schedules—no complex meal plans required. For deeper science, Autophagy: Cancer, Other Pathologies, Inflammation, Immunity, Infection, and Aging offers research-backed insights, but pair it with my simpler explanations in The Fasting Reset to avoid overwhelm.

How to Activate Autophagy Safely as a Beginner

Start with a gentle 12:12 fasting window and gradually extend to 16:8. Black coffee, herbal tea, and water keep you hydrated while triggering autophagy. Focus on nutrient-dense meals in your eating window—think leafy greens, healthy fats, and moderate protein—to manage diabetes and blood pressure. If joint pain limits movement, walking after your eating window enhances the anti-inflammatory effects of autophagy without strain.

Track symptoms like mental clarity and reduced cravings instead of the scale. Most clients lose 1-2 pounds weekly once autophagy becomes consistent, breaking the cycle of diet failure.
